Description 1 2 Keys 3-11 3 4 5 6 7 8 Display See section "Display information" on page 14. Settings Used to enter or leave setting mode. See sections "Settings" on page 71 and "Menu structure (Settings)" on page 19. This feature is mandatory and is programmed to this position by default. Preprogrammed keys / Function keys The keys are programmed with the specified default features (see below). The features can be moved to any other programmable function key by the system administrator. The features can also be removed from the keys (by your system administrator). In this case you can program frequently used features and phone numbers on the keys. See section "Programming of function keys" on page 72. Follow-me Indicates an activated Follow-me. Also used to deactivate Followme. See section "Call Forwarding" on page 47. Message Message indication key. When the key lamp is on, it is an indication that you have a new message. See section "Messages" on page 59. Call Waiting Activating Call Waiting for a busy extension. See section ""When you receive a busy tone" on page 36. Call List Used to access the list of outgoing and incoming calls. When the key lamp is flashing, there are unanswered incoming calls. See sections "Redial calls from the Call List" on page 35 and "Call List" on page 41. Conference Establish a conference. See section "Conference" on page 45. Callback Indicating/activating Callback.
